我们准备用Dephi开发数据库系统,对数据编辑后保存的方式有人提出:数据录入Edit框,然后从Edit框中取得数据,用Sql(Insert、update)的形式保存进数据库。理由是DbEdit控件有问题,而且效率不高,不知道是不是真的有问题,请教各位。
我的理由是:基类窗口定义好,用DBEdit开发效率高,不用写那么多代码,先把数据
录入Edit框,然后从Edit框中取得数据,用Sql(Insert、update)的形式保存进数据库,这样岂不是脱裤子放屁倒手续吗。
所以想请大家提提意见,尤其是在这方面有经验的,你们一般用哪个?我现在到底该用哪个,有什么问题,有什么优点?
谢谢回帖

解决方案 »

  1.   

    一般都用edit
    对于dbedit 里面只不过多了一个datasource 可以通过这个直接连到数据库的datasource中
    常用的是用ado控件直接实现数据库的连接
    而edit里面的数据是经过处理以后的。所以不要用dbedit
      

  2.   

    当然是用DBEdit,borland已经做好的东东不用,简直就是傻。
      

  3.   

    两个可以一起用嘛,其实单单是显示或者保存数据dbedit应该是最方便的
      

  4.   

    我现在是被强迫用非数据感知控件,以前我用的是数据感知控件。现在感觉实在是不爽,用edit要写的东西实在是太多了,还要约束什么之类的一大堆。还是觉得用数据感知控件的好。